Which property is represented below?
(7 * 3) * 8 = 8 * (7 * 3)

Answer:

  commutative property

Step-by-step explanation:

The commutative property of multiplication lets you swap the order of the operands (7*3) and 8 to make them have the order 8 and (7*3).
